State Mahila Congress general secretary removed for ‘indiscipline’

Party leadership dismisses claims of cash-for-ticket scam as politically motivated

by TheReportingTimes

Chandigarh, March 12: Suchitra Devi has been stripped of her position as the general secretary of the Haryana Mahila Congress after leveling bribery charges against the party’s central leadership. Haryana Mahila Congress president Pearl Chaudhary issued the expulsion orders this week, citing a breach of organizational norms and the spreading of misinformation.

The controversy arose when Devi declared that a sum of Rs 7 crore was sought from her to secure a candidacy for the Bawal Assembly seat. She asserted that the high command was involved in these financial demands, leading to widespread debate in Haryana’s political circles.

Responding to the claims, the state unit stated that the allegations were “politically motivated” and lacked any factual basis. Leaders maintained that the integrity of the top leadership remains intact and that the party would not tolerate internal attempts to tarnish its reputation.

“Strict action was necessary to maintain discipline and the party’s image,” the state chief declared following a review of the matter. While the development has intensified debate between rival parties, the Congress remains firm that the move was a necessary internal correction to address conduct that violated the party’s core principles.
